What are the respiratory changes that occur with insufflation
increased intra-ab pressure
increased shunt
increased atelectasis
decreased FRC and compliance
How much should MV be increased to offset CO2 from insufflation
12-25%
What are the cardiac changes that occur with insufflation
increased MAP, SVR, filling pressures
decreased preload and CI
When does CO2 absorption plateau
15-30 minutes
What will occur with IAP increases to greater that 20 torr
hypotension
bradycardia
What are 3 signs of CO2 embolus
decreased SaO2
decreased BP
Decreased EtCO2
